AUBURN — Auburn residents are invited to meet with School Superintendent Katy Grondin at 6 p.m. Tuesday, March 26, at Rolly’s Diner.

The meeting is facilitated by the United New Auburn Association taxpayer group. UNNA President Leroy Walker, also a city councilor, said people want to hear Grondin’s thoughts on the proposed new Edward Little High School, and how it would be funded.

“It’s a big topic,” Walker said.

Also at the meeting will be Reine Mynahan, Auburn’s Community Development Block Grant director, who will talk about improving the New Auburn downtown.

A question-and-answer session will be held, and refreshments will be served.
